Bug 166435 - Kget crashed once when I tried to download googleearth, cannot reproduce
Summary: Kget crashed once when I tried to download googleearth, cannot reproduce
Status: RESOLVED DUPLICATE of bug 163171
Alias: None
Product: kio
Classification: Frameworks and Libraries
Component: general (show other bugs)
Version: unspecified
Platform: Compiled Sources Linux
: NOR crash
Target Milestone: ---
Assignee: David Faure
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2008-07-13 12:03 UTC by auxsvr
Modified: 2008-10-10 10:32 UTC (History)
2 users (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description auxsvr 2008-07-13 12:03:45 UTC
Version:           Version 2.0.85
Using KDE 4.00.85 (KDE 4.0.85 (KDE 4.1 >= 20080703) "release 1.1 (using Devel)
Installed from:    Compiled sources
Compiler:          gcc (SUSE Linux) 4.3.1 20080507 (prerelease) [gcc-4_3-branch revision 135036] 
OS:                Linux

When I tried to download googleearth, kget was missing the downloaded files history and crashed before it started downloading. Here's the backtrace:

Application: KGet (kget), signal SIGSEGV
[?1034h(no debugging symbols found)
[Thread debugging using libthread_db enabled]
[New Thread 0xb63756d0 (LWP 12759)]
[KCrash handler]
#6  0xb7610d22 in QUrl::host (this=0x8262580) at io/qurl.cpp:4247
#7  0xb7ae230b in searchIdleList (idleSlaves=@0x83204c4, url=@0x72616873, 
    protocol=@0xbf84d0a4, exact=@0xbf84d13f)
    at /usr/src/debug/kdelibs-4.0.85/kio/kio/scheduler.cpp:608
#8  0xb7ae5e34 in KIO::SchedulerPrivate::findIdleSlave (this=0x8320470, 
    job=0x82d3120, exact=@0xbf84d13f)
    at /usr/src/debug/kdelibs-4.0.85/kio/kio/scheduler.cpp:682
#9  0xb7ae673f in KIO::SchedulerPrivate::startJobDirect (this=0x8320470)
    at /usr/src/debug/kdelibs-4.0.85/kio/kio/scheduler.cpp:587
#10 0xb7ae68e0 in KIO::SchedulerPrivate::startStep (this=0x8320470)
    at /usr/src/debug/kdelibs-4.0.85/kio/kio/scheduler.cpp:432
#11 0xb7ae6b46 in KIO::Scheduler::qt_metacall (this=0x82f7cc8, 
    _c=QMetaObject::InvokeMetaMethod, _id=6, _a=0xbf84d228)
    at /usr/src/debug/kdelibs-4.0.85/build/kio/scheduler.moc:101
#12 0xb765c3fa in QMetaObject::activate (sender=0x8320474, 
    from_signal_index=4, to_signal_index=4, argv=0x0)
    at kernel/qobject.cpp:3007
#13 0xb765c972 in QMetaObject::activate (sender=0x8320474, m=0xb76e69e4, 
    local_signal_index=0, argv=0x0) at kernel/qobject.cpp:3080
#14 0xb76919a7 in QTimer::timeout (this=0x8320474)
    at .moc/release-shared/moc_qtimer.cpp:126
#15 0xb7663abe in QTimer::timerEvent (this=0x8320474, e=0xbf84d6cc)
    at kernel/qtimer.cpp:263
#16 0xb7658d1f in QObject::event (this=0x8320474, e=0xbf84d6cc)
    at kernel/qobject.cpp:1105
#17 0xb6a44ecc in QApplicationPrivate::notify_helper (this=0x80bb4b0, 
    receiver=0x8320474, e=0xbf84d6cc) at kernel/qapplication.cpp:3772
#18 0xb6a4b31e in QApplication::notify (this=0xbf84da58, receiver=0x8320474, 
    e=0xbf84d6cc) at kernel/qapplication.cpp:3366
#19 0xb7e7a5dd in KApplication::notify (this=0xbf84da58, receiver=0x8320474, 
    event=0xbf84d6cc)
    at /usr/src/debug/kdelibs-4.0.85/kdeui/kernel/kapplication.cpp:311
#20 0xb764ab51 in QCoreApplication::notifyInternal (this=0xbf84da58, 
    receiver=0x8320474, event=0xbf84d6cc) at kernel/qcoreapplication.cpp:583
#21 0xb7673181 in QTimerInfoList::activateTimers (this=0x80bbcbc)
    at kernel/qcoreapplication.h:215
#22 0xb76733fb in QEventDispatcherUNIX::processEvents (this=0x80b55e0, flags=
      {i = -1081813048}) at kernel/qeventdispatcher_unix.cpp:899
#23 0xb6acf0a2 in QEventDispatcherX11::processEvents (this=0x80b55e0, flags=
      {i = -1081812600}) at kernel/qeventdispatcher_x11.cpp:154
#24 0xb76492ca in QEventLoop::processEvents (this=0xbf84d9f0, flags=
      {i = -1081812536}) at kernel/qeventloop.cpp:149
#25 0xb764948a in QEventLoop::exec (this=0xbf84d9f0, flags={i = -1081812488})
    at kernel/qeventloop.cpp:196
#26 0xb764b66d in QCoreApplication::exec () at kernel/qcoreapplication.cpp:845
#27 0xb6a44d47 in QApplication::exec () at kernel/qapplication.cpp:3304
#28 0x08095aaa in _start ()
#0  0xffffe430 in __kernel_vsyscall ()
Comment 1 Urs Wolfer 2008-07-15 20:13:04 UTC
Looks like a crash in KIO.
Comment 2 Raúl 2008-09-09 20:17:58 UTC
Hello:

I've found this working on 4.1.1, please retest and close if convenient.

Regards,
Comment 3 auxsvr 2008-10-10 10:19:03 UTC
Bug #170869 looks like a duplicate of this. I had another crash with KDE 4.1.2 today that is similar:

Application: KGet (kget), signal SIGSEGV
[?1034h(no debugging symbols found)
[Thread debugging using libthread_db enabled]
[New Thread 0xb5fed700 (LWP 3265)]
[KCrash handler]
#6  QUrl::host (this=0x72) at io/qurl.cpp:4247
#7  0xb7a8d7fb in searchIdleList (idleSlaves=@0x826ff24, url=@0x72, 
    protocol=@0xbfde7cc4, exact=@0xbfde7d5f)
    at /usr/src/debug/kdelibs-4.1.2/kio/kio/scheduler.cpp:609
#8  0xb7a91374 in KIO::SchedulerPrivate::findIdleSlave (this=0x826fed0, 
    job=0x825f068, exact=@0xbfde7d5f)
    at /usr/src/debug/kdelibs-4.1.2/kio/kio/scheduler.cpp:683
#9  0xb7a91c6f in KIO::SchedulerPrivate::startJobDirect (this=0x826fed0)
    at /usr/src/debug/kdelibs-4.1.2/kio/kio/scheduler.cpp:588
#10 0xb7a91e10 in KIO::SchedulerPrivate::startStep (this=0x826fed0)
    at /usr/src/debug/kdelibs-4.1.2/kio/kio/scheduler.cpp:433
#11 0xb7a92076 in KIO::Scheduler::qt_metacall (this=0x826ff60, 
    _c=QMetaObject::InvokeMetaMethod, _id=6, _a=0xbfde7e48)
    at /usr/src/debug/kdelibs-4.1.2/build/kio/scheduler.moc:101
#12 0xb75bd730 in QMetaObject::activate (sender=0x826fed4, 
    from_signal_index=4, to_signal_index=4, argv=0x0)
    at kernel/qobject.cpp:3031
#13 0xb75be4b2 in QMetaObject::activate (sender=0x826fed4, m=0xb768c904, 
    local_signal_index=0, argv=0x0) at kernel/qobject.cpp:3101
#14 0xb75f8bb7 in QTimer::timeout (this=0x826fed4)
    at .moc/release-shared/moc_qtimer.cpp:126
#15 0xb75c41ce in QTimer::timerEvent (this=0x826fed4, e=0xbfde8310)
    at kernel/qtimer.cpp:257
#16 0xb75b81ef in QObject::event (this=0x826fed4, e=0xbfde8310)
    at kernel/qobject.cpp:1120
#17 0xb678b82c in QApplicationPrivate::notify_helper (this=0x80bb8a8, 
    receiver=0x826fed4, e=0xbfde8310) at kernel/qapplication.cpp:3803
#18 0xb67936ce in QApplication::notify (this=0xbfde85c8, receiver=0x826fed4, 
    e=0xbfde8310) at kernel/qapplication.cpp:3393
#19 0xb7e0ce0d in KApplication::notify (this=0xbfde85c8, receiver=0x826fed4, 
    event=0xbfde8310)
    at /usr/src/debug/kdelibs-4.1.2/kdeui/kernel/kapplication.cpp:311
#20 0xb75a8a61 in QCoreApplication::notifyInternal (this=0xbfde85c8, 
    receiver=0x826fed4, event=0xbfde8310) at kernel/qcoreapplication.cpp:587
#21 0xb75d6dd6 in QTimerInfoList::activateTimers (this=0x80be6c4)
    at kernel/qcoreapplication.h:209
#22 0xb75d32a0 in timerSourceDispatch (source=0x80be690)
    at kernel/qeventdispatcher_glib.cpp:160
#23 0xb61112d9 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#24 0xb611485b in ?? () from /usr/lib/libglib-2.0.so.0
#25 0xb61149d8 in g_main_context_iteration () from /usr/lib/libglib-2.0.so.0
#26 0xb75d31f8 in QEventDispatcherGlib::processEvents (this=0x80bb978, flags=
      {i = -1075936072}) at kernel/qeventdispatcher_glib.cpp:319
#27 0xb6824885 in QGuiEventDispatcherGlib::processEvents (this=0x80bb978, 
    flags={i = -1075936024}) at kernel/qguieventdispatcher_glib.cpp:198
#28 0xb75a713a in QEventLoop::processEvents (this=0xbfde8560, flags=
      {i = -1075935960}) at kernel/qeventloop.cpp:143
#29 0xb75a72fa in QEventLoop::exec (this=0xbfde8560, flags={i = -1075935896})
    at kernel/qeventloop.cpp:194
#30 0xb75a9995 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:845
#31 0xb678b6a7 in QApplication::exec () at kernel/qapplication.cpp:3331
#32 0x0809616a in _start ()
#0  0xffffe430 in __kernel_vsyscall ()
Comment 4 auxsvr 2008-10-10 10:24:33 UTC
This also looks similar to bug #170115 and bug #163171. It must be a kdelibs issue.
Comment 5 auxsvr 2008-10-10 10:28:27 UTC
This is a duplicate of bug #163171.
Comment 6 David Faure 2008-10-10 10:32:37 UTC

*** This bug has been marked as a duplicate of bug 163171 ***